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75395424 1781 5384700 127 44175
1401713 5380652116 255
1401713 5380652116 255
08099 0358639105 82
All about undefined
Interested in learning more?
1401713 5380652116 255
08099 0358639105 82
See more
7349545377 71
69 1347 3782932143 195 672
See more
10774 104188007
349 15 51708205 9881347248
See more